NBA All Star Game Ratings Hit All-Time Low

The NBA All Star game proved to be a massive waste of time with the dwindling game hitting an all-time low in ratings and viewership.

The NBA All-Star game ratings reportedly tanked this year dropping a remarkable 24% from the previous game.

“Sunday’s NBA All-Star Game, which included the Dunk Contest at halftime, averaged a combined 3.1 rating and 5.94 million viewers across TNT and TBS — down 24% in ratings and 18% in viewership from last year (4.1, 7.28M) and the lowest rated and least-watched edition of the game,” Sports Media Watch reported.

The once popular All-Star game was notably competing against the Oprah’s interview with Meghan Markle and Prince Harry on CBS.

“In the key young adult demographics, the All-Star Game ranked second for the night in adults 18-49 with a 2.4 rating. The aforementioned CBS interview had a 2.7,” according to Sports Media Watch.

The CBS interview with Prince Harry and Meghan Markle was watched by an insanely large 17.8 million people audience.
